Safety and Handling
GHS H Statement
May cause damage to organs through prolonged or repeated exposure.
Fatal if inhaled.
Toxic to aquatic life with long lasting effects.
May intensify fire; oxidizer.
Fatal if swallowed.
GHS P Statement
IF SWALLOWED: Immediately call a POISON CENTER or doctor/physician.
IF INHALED: Remove victim to fresh air and keep at rest in a position comfortable for breathing.
Immediately call a POISON CENTER or doctor/physician.
GHS Signal Word: Danger
